Book Recommendations
- Sadako and the Thousand Paper Cranes by Eleanor Coerr: A heartwarming story inspired by a true event about a young girl's journey to fold a thousand paper cranes and her hope for peace.
- Hiroshima by John Hersey: A non-fiction book that tells the stories of six survivors of the atomic bombing of Hiroshima, providing a firsthand account of the devastating event.
- Barefoot Gen by Keiji Nakazawa: A manga series that follows the life of a young boy in Hiroshima before, during, and after the atomic bombing, offering a powerful and poignant depiction of the tragedy.
